Tornado Watch Issued for East-Central Minnesota, Northwest Wisconsin

According to National Weather Service, large hail, damaging winds, and a few tornadoes are all possible.

DULUTH, Minn.- The National Weather Service has issued a tornado watch until 4 p.m. Saturday for much of east-central Minnesota and Northwest Wisconsin. Update: Greenwood Fire Nears 10K Acres, Containment Remains at 0%

The fire received minimal precipitation Friday night. Crews anticipate that winds capable of producing active fire behavior will continue. 

Photo: Superior National Forest SOUTH OF ISABELLA, Minn.- Crews continue battling the Greenwood Fire as it grew to 9,062 acres Saturday morning after minimal precipitation and high winds overnight, according to the U.S. Forest Service-Superior National Forest. On Saturday, operations staff will reinforce the southern line of the fire in the area of Hwy 2 and the McDougal Lake area….

Duluth Fire Warns of Dangerous Swimming Conditions Due to High Rip Current Risk

Officials warn to stay out of the water regardless of your swimming experience.

DULUTH, Minn.- The Duluth Fire Department issued a dangerous swimming condition warning for Park Point beaches Saturday, due to the high risk of rip currents, effective immediately. According to the Duluth Fire Department the warning lasts until 10:00 a.m. August 8. This warning means that wind and wave conditions can support rip currents.
